Course Details
• Introduction to Climate-Responsive Construction: Understanding the principles of climate-responsive design and construction, with a focus on using 3D printing technology.
• 3D Printing Technology for Construction: Exploring the different types of 3D printing technologies used in construction, including material extrusion, vat photopolymerization, and powder bed fusion.
• Sustainable Materials for 3D Printing: Examining the environmental impact of 3D printing materials and identifying sustainable alternatives, such as bio-based materials and recycled materials.
• Climate-Responsive Design with 3D Printing: Learning how to design buildings that respond to their specific climatic conditions using 3D printing technology.
• Energy-Efficient Construction with 3D Printing: Understanding how to reduce energy consumption during the construction process and design buildings that are energy efficient in operation.
• Case Studies in Climate-Responsive 3D Printing: Analyzing real-world examples of successful climate-responsive 3D printing projects and identifying best practices.
• Building Physics and 3D Printing: Examining the impact of 3D printing on building physics, including thermal performance, air tightness, and moisture management.
• Regulations and Standards for Climate-Responsive 3D Printing: Understanding the current regulations and standards related to 3D printing in construction and how they impact climate-responsive design.
• Future Trends in Climate-Responsive 3D Printing: Exploring emerging trends and technologies in climate-responsive 3D printing, including automation, digital fabrication, and artificial intelligence.
• Practical Application of Climate-Responsive 3D Printing: Hands-on experience with 3D printing technology and climate-responsive design principles, including site visits to operational 3D printing construction sites.
